Command audit engine
Policy verdicts for every command
Command control isn't just block-or-allow. Four graduated verdicts let you match control strength to risk.
| Verdict | What happens | Typical use |
|---|---|---|
| BLOCK + TERMINATE | Command is stopped, the session is killed instantly, and the SOC is alerted. | Destructive operations on production: rm -rf, DROP DATABASE, destructive changes on network devices. |
| BLOCK + NOTIFY | Command is stopped, session continues, administrators are notified. | Risky-but-recoverable actions: service restarts, config edits outside change windows. |
| JUSTIFY | User must enter a business justification before the command executes; justification is logged. | Sensitive reads: exporting customer tables, accessing payment logs. |
| ALLOW + WARN | Command runs, user sees a caution, event is highlighted in the audit trail. | Discouraged patterns you still permit: sudo to shared accounts, legacy tooling. |
Time-based & JIT access
Privilege that expires by itself
Change-window access
The DBA team gets production database access every Saturday 22:00-02:00 - outside the window, the door doesn't exist.
Incident JIT elevation
An on-call engineer requests emergency root for one hour; approval arrives on the approver's phone; access self-destructs at minute sixty.
Vendor time-boxing
A hardware vendor gets RDP to one jump-target for Tuesday's maintenance - recorded, watermarked, and gone by Wednesday.
